Epos Now Overview

Epos Now is a cloud-based POS system for retail and hospitality with over 100 app integrations. Features include inventory management, staff management, and 24/7 support. Offers complete hardware bundles.

Epos Now is offered by Epos Now (founded 2011) based in Norwich, United Kingdom. The system focuses on Retail, Hospitality, Restaurants, Bars.

Helcim Overview

Helcim provides interchange-plus payment processing with free POS software and card readers. Known for transparent pricing, no contracts, and volume-based discounts for growing businesses.

Helcim is offered by Helcim Inc. (founded 2006) based in Calgary, Canada. The system focuses on Retail, Service, B2B.

Pros and Cons

Epos Now

Pros:

  • 100+ integrations
  • Hardware bundles available
  • 24/7 support
  • Easy to use
  • Flexible pricing

Cons:

  • Hardware can be expensive
  • Some integrations cost extra
  • Support quality varies

Helcim

Pros:

  • Transparent interchange-plus pricing
  • Free POS and card reader
  • No contracts or hidden fees
  • Volume discounts

Cons:

  • Limited POS features vs competitors
  • Processing only – not full POS
  • US and Canada only
